Semantic essence of asml: Extended abstract


Journal Article

The Abstract State Machine Language, AsmL, is a novel executable specification language based on the theory of Abstract State Machines. AsmL is object-oriented, provides high-level mathematical datastructures, and is built around the notion of synchronous updates and finite choice. AsmL is fully integrated into the .NET framework and Microsoft development tools. In this paper, we explain the design rationale of AsmL and sketch semantics for a kernel of the language. The details will appear in the full version of the paper. © Springer-Verlag 2004.

Full Text

Duke Authors

Cited Authors

  • Gurevich, Y; Rossman, B; Schulte, W

Published Date

  • January 1, 2004

Published In

Volume / Issue

  • 3188 /

Start / End Page

  • 240 - 259

Electronic International Standard Serial Number (EISSN)

  • 1611-3349

International Standard Serial Number (ISSN)

  • 0302-9743

Digital Object Identifier (DOI)

  • 10.1007/978-3-540-30101-1_11

Citation Source

  • Scopus